How Lagos Police Arrested Robbery Suspect Who Killed Woman, 65 & Carted Away Toyota Sienna  

Posted on May 5, 2025

MICHAEL AKINOLA 


Operatives from the Lagos State Police Command have arrested one of the prime robbery suspects, Abubakar Iliyasu, who murdered a 65-year old woman, Mrs. Jane Okoye and robbed her of Toyota Sienna during the operation. 

 

P.M.EXPRESS reports that the incident happened at the victim’s residence in the Orile Iganmu area of Lagos on Wednesday, 2nd April, 2025.

 

But the suspect was arrested in Ankpa, Kogi State, and the stolen Toyota Sienna linked to the crime was successfully recovered as exhibit.

 

This was disclosed by the Lagos State Police Public Relations Officer, CSP Benjamin Hundeyin, who confirmed the arrest of the suspect and recovery of the vehicle.

 

He stated that the suspect allegedly broke into the victim’s home, attacked her and fled with her Toyota Sienna and other personal belongings.

The victim was later discovered unconscious, was rushed to an undisclosed hospital, where she was later pronounced dead by Medical Doctors.

The matter was transferred to the State Criminal Investigation Department (SCID), Yaba, where homicide detectives launched a discreet but intensive investigation and it paid off.

“Using advanced intelligence and surveillance techniques, the team traced Iliyasu to Kogi State and effected his arrest. The stolen Toyota Sienna was recovered in good condition and is now in Police custody as evidence.”

“The suspect is currently detained at the SCID, where he is assisting Police with the ongoing investigation.”

The Commissioner of Police, Lagos State Command, CP Olohundare Jimoh, has assured residents that justice will be served and reiterated the Command’s unwavering commitment to protecting lives and property across the state.
